Description
The Senior Corporate Accountant is responsible for supporting the company’s corporate and consolidated financial reporting processes, ensuring accurate and timely financial information in accordance with U.S. GAAP. This role plays a key part in the monthly and quarterly close process, consolidation activities, intercompany accounting, and audit support within a dynamic multi-entity environment.
The Senior Corporate Accountant partners closely with Corporate Accounting leadership, FP&A, Treasury, operational finance teams, and external auditors to support consolidated reporting, maintain strong internal controls, and drive process improvements across the accounting function. This position offers significant exposure to technical accounting, financial reporting, and cross-functional collaboration within a global organization.
Key Responsibilities
Support the monthly and quarterly close process for corporate and consolidated reporting, including preparation of journal entries, reconciliations, and supporting schedules in accordance with established deadlines
Assist with the preparation of consolidated financial statements, including consolidation entries, intercompany eliminations, and variance analysis of subsidiary results
Maintain consolidation and reporting structures within SAP/BPC, including entity hierarchies, account mappings, and intercompany relationships
Support intercompany accounting processes, including reconciliation of balances, investigation of variances, and preparation of elimination schedules
Perform accounting research related to complex transactions and new accounting guidance; assist with preparation of technical accounting memos and accounting policy documentation
Execute and document key internal controls related to the close and consolidation process, ensuring compliance with company policies and audit requirements
Support external audit activities by preparing schedules, responding to audit requests, and assisting with supporting documentation for corporate and consolidated reporting areas
Partner with FP&A to analyze consolidated financial results, investigate variances to budget and forecast, and support management reporting requirements
Assist Treasury with preparation of financial information required for lender reporting, credit agreements, and bank audits
Prepare complex journal entries and supporting schedules related to corporate accounting activities, including equity accounting, allocations, and consolidation adjustments
Identify opportunities for process improvement and automation within the close and reporting cycle, leveraging SAP and other reporting tools
Support accounting projects and initiatives related to system implementations, process enhancements, and reporting improvements
Collaborate with accounting team members to promote consistency in processes, documentation, and best practices across the organization
